UPDATED: Toddler Dies in Southwest Columbus Shooting

Update: According to 10tv, a second suspect has been identified as part of the Tuesday’s quadruple shooting. The suspect’s name is Jaquon Lamont Poindexter, 22, and was found through investigations and arrest warrants Thursday. 

Four people were victims of a quadruple shooting on Parkwick Drive, one of which was a two-year-old girl who died of a fatal gunshot wound, according to NBC4i.

Two other victims were identified as Julian M. Bice and Jessica C. Stanford, who were both taken to different hospitals to treat their wounds. The fourth victim of the shooting was the shooter himself, Norman Robert Burke, who was taken into medical care in critical condition.

Police said to NBC4i that Burke and another unidentified suspect fired multiple shots and it is still not clear who shot Burke — whether it was self-inflicted or the fault of the unID’d suspect.

Burke has been charged with two counts of felonious assault and one count of murder. The young girl was not directly identified, but was taken to Nationwide Children’s Hospital where she was pronounced dead.
